Cranberry Panda is looking for a Social Media & Influencer Manager to join their London team. This role offers the chance to work with a globally recognized luxury brand, contributing to social media, influencer programs, and content creation.

You will own the brand's social presence, working closely with marketing and creative teams to shape digital storytelling. The ideal candidate has luxury brand experience, strong content creation skills, and thrives in a collaborative environ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Cranberry Panda

Showcase Your Creative Campaigns

Get ready to flaunt your portfolio! Include examples of previous marketing campaigns you've worked on, especially those that showcase your creativity and strategy. Recruiters at Cranberry Panda will be keen to see how you conceptualise and execute campaigns, so highlight any measurable outcomes to back up your claims.

Know Your Digital Tools Inside Out

If you’re heading into a marketing-communications role, make sure you're comfortable discussing key digital marketing tools like Google Analytics, HubSpot, or Hootsuite. Expect some technical questions about how you've used these tools in the past, as they'll want to gauge your hands-on experience and how you analyse data to drive marketing decisions.

Be Ready for Scenario-Based Questions

At Cranberry Panda, they may throw some scenario-based questions your way, aimed at testing your problem-solving skills in real-life marketing situations. Think through potential challenges you’ve faced, how you navigated them, and be prepared to discuss your thought process and outcome.
